Matthias Gamer is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Social Psychology and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Matthias Gamer has authored 126 papers receiving a total of 3.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 79 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 54 papers in Social Psychology and 39 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Matthias Gamer’s work include Deception detection and forensic psychology (30 papers), Psychopathy, Forensic Psychiatry, Sexual Offending (23 papers) and Face Recognition and Perception (23 papers). Matthias Gamer is often cited by papers focused on Deception detection and forensic psychology (30 papers), Psychopathy, Forensic Psychiatry, Sexual Offending (23 papers) and Face Recognition and Perception (23 papers). Matthias Gamer coll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Belgium and The Netherlands. Matthias Gamer's co-authors include Christian Büchel, Bartosz Zurowski, Gerhard Vossel, Heiko Hecht, Stefanie Brassen, Sabrina Boll, Sabine C. Herpertz, Stefan Berti, Gregor Domes and Bruno Verschuère and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Neuroscience.
